A physical fitness association is including the mile run in its secondary-school fitness test. The time for this event for boys in secondary school is known to possess a normal distribution with a mean of 450 seconds and a standard deviation of 40 seconds. Between what times do we expect approximately 95% of the boys to run the mile?

Answer:

Between 371.6 seconds or 528.4 seconds.

Step-by-step explanation:

Thanks to the normal distribution table (attached) we know that:

95% would be a z between -1.96 and +1.96

z = (x- m) / sd

where x is the value we want to calculate, m is the mean (450) and sd is the set deviation (40). Now, replacing we have:

+ -1.96 = (x-450) / 40

+ -78.4 = x-450

x = 450 + - 78.4

x1 = 528.4

x2 = 371.6

In other words, the result is between 371.6 seconds or 528.4 seconds.
